问题描述
基本问题:
我有两台计算机,一台有触摸屏,但没有可用的USB端口,另一台有我可以连接触摸屏的USB端口。我想将触摸屏的点击和移动传递给另一台计算机。
CURL_DISABLE_OPENSSL_AUTO_LOAD_CONFIG
我正在用C ++进行编程,并且已经编写了一些代码来读取相应的+================+
| Touchscreen |
| +------------+ | +------------+
| | | | | |
| | Monitor 1 | | | Monitor 2 |
| | | | | |
| +------------+ | +------------+
| ^ +----------------------+ ^
| | | USB Cable | |
+================+ | |
| | |
| HDMI Cable | | HDMI Cable
| | |
+-------+--------+ | +-------+--------+
| | +->| |
| Computer A | Network Cable | Computer B |
| |<----------------------->| |
+----------------+ +----------------+
设备。我得到正确的数据,并可以通过网络电缆发送它。没问题但是,计算机B仍然收到等效的鼠标移动和鼠标点击。
我想做的是打开相应的USB端口(例如/dev/input/mouse2
)而不是/dev/bus/usb/001/005
(如果有帮助),并且根本无法识别触摸屏在计算机A上。
我该如何设置X11,使其完全不尝试使用触摸屏?
我可以看到随附的USB设备中列出的触摸屏:
/dev/input/mouse2
因此,我相信这是用来使触摸屏作为鼠标可用的原因。
请注意,我不介意$ lsusb
Bus 001 Device 005: ID 1aad:000f KeeTouch
。我不希望X11接收/生成触摸屏消息。
解决方法
暂无找到可以解决该程序问题的有效方法,小编努力寻找整理中!
如果你已经找到好的解决方法,欢迎将解决方案带上本链接一起发送给小编。
小编邮箱:dio#foxmail.com (将#修改为@)